The save file is divided into blocks (e.g., Block 0: Trainer Info, Block 1: Game Time, Block 2: PC Boxes). The editor parses these blocks using a schema derived from reverse-engineered game code.

If you want granular control—changing a Pokémon's nature, IVs, moves, or even its shiny status—you need to move beyond PowerSaves. This involves installing Custom Firmware (CFW) on your 3DS using tools like and Luma3DS .
